OH NO! NO LOW! Low Tickets
But the band do plan on returning to the continent in the near future...
LOW have cancelled their upcoming European live dates.
They were due to appear at the Witnness Festival in Ireland and Benicassim Festival in southern Spain this weekend (August 3-5), and also had a gig at Liquid Rooms in Edinburgh as part of the T On The Fringe line-up during Edinburgh Festival on August 7.
No reason has been given for the cancellation. But according to their website www.chairkickers.com, they are planning to return to Europe in the autumn.
Witnness would have seen the first live collaboration between Low and The Dirty 3, who jointly released an album as part of the 'In The Fish Tank' series on Konkurrent records.
